Common praise
✓High sustained brightness✓Good balance of price and features✓Versatile beam types (spot, flood, red)✓Lightweight and compact for a triple channel headlamp✓USB-C charging convenient✓Regulated output for stable brightness
✓Strong build quality and solid construction✓Dual emitters provide flexible lighting options✓USB-C onboard charging with included 21700 battery✓Good value for price under $50 with included battery✓Convenient magnetic tailcap and clip for retention
Common complaints
⚠No glass lens protection (optic exposed)⚠Magnet weak on thin metal⚠Lacks lanyard attachment included⚠Tailcap design hinders flat tailstanding with lanyard attached
⚠Relatively heavy for a headlamp at 130 grams without battery⚠Floodlight mode less powerful compared to spot emitter⚠Top switch placement can make headstanding unstable⚠Some users may find the included strap non-removable
